:orphan: .. raw:: html .. dtcompatible:: maxim,max20335-charger .. _dtbinding_maxim_max20335_charger: maxim,max20335-charger ###################### Vendor: :ref:`Maxim Integrated Products ` .. note:: An implementation of a driver matching this compatible is available in :zephyr_file:`drivers/charger/charger_max20335.c`. Description *********** .. code-block:: none Maxim MAX20335 battery charger Properties ********** .. tabs:: .. group-tab:: Node specific properties Properties not inherited from the base binding file. .. list-table:: :widths: 1 1 4 :header-rows: 1 * - Name - Type - Details * - ``constant-charge-voltage-max-microvolt`` - ``int`` - .. code-block:: none maximum constant input voltage This property is **required**. Legal values: ``4050000``, ``4100000``, ``4150000``, ``4200000``, ``4250000``, ``4300000``, ``4350000``, ``4400000``, ``4450000``, ``4500000``, ``4550000``, ``4600000`` * - ``chgin-to-sys-current-limit-microamp`` - ``int`` - .. code-block:: none CHGIN to SYS path current limitter configuration. Refer to ILimCntl register description for details. This property is **required**. Legal values: ``0``, ``100000``, ``500000``, ``1000000`` * - ``system-voltage-min-threshold-microvolt`` - ``int`` - .. code-block:: none System voltage minimum threshold. When SYS path voltage drops to this level, the charger current is reduced to prevent battery damage. This property is **required**. Legal values: ``3600000``, ``3700000``, ``3800000``, ``3900000``, ``4000000``, ``4100000``, ``4200000``, ``4300000`` * - ``re-charge-threshold-microvolt`` - ``int`` - .. code-block:: none Recharge threshold in relation to BatReg. Refer to ChgCntlA register description for details. This property is **required**. Legal values: ``70000``, ``120000``, ``170000``, ``220000`` * - ``thermistor-monitoring-mode`` - ``string`` - .. code-block:: none Thermistor monitoring mode. Refer to ThrmCfg register description and Table 2 for details. This property is **required**. Legal values: ``'disabled'``, ``'thermistor'``, ``'JEITA-1'``, ``'JEITA-2'`` * - ``int-gpios`` - ``phandle-array`` - .. code-block:: none Interrupt pin This property is **required**. * - ``device-chemistry`` - ``string`` - .. code-block:: none This describes the chemical technology of the battery. The "lithium-ion" value is a blanket type for all lithium-ion batteries. If the specific chemistry is unknown, this value can be used instead of the precise "lithium-ion-X" options. Legal values: ``'nickel-cadmium'``, ``'nickel-metal-hydride'``, ``'lithium-ion'``, ``'lithium-ion-polymer'``, ``'lithium-ion-iron-phosphate'``, ``'lithium-ion-manganese-oxide'`` * - ``ocv-capacity-table-0`` - ``array`` - .. code-block:: none An array providing the open circuit voltage (OCV) , which is used to look up battery capacity according to current OCV value. The OCV unit is microvolts. Unlike the linux equivalent this array is required to be 11 elements long, representing the voltages for 0-100% charge in 10% steps. * - ``charge-full-design-microamp-hours`` - ``int`` - .. code-block:: none battery design capacity * - ``re-charge-voltage-microvolt`` - ``int`` - .. code-block:: none limit to automatically start charging again * - ``precharge-current-microamp`` - ``int`` - .. code-block:: none current for pre-charge phase * - ``charge-term-current-microamp`` - ``int`` - .. code-block:: none current for charge termination phase * - ``constant-charge-current-max-microamp`` - ``int`` - .. code-block:: none maximum constant input current .. group-tab:: Deprecated node specific properties Deprecated properties not inherited from the base binding file.
